Founded in 1994, the Palmer College of Chiropractic West Sports Council continues to be a leader in the education and professional development of the next generation of sports chiropractors. Through practical, skill-building opportunities, Council members gain the knowledge and experience that will allow them to be at the forefront of the profession after graduation.
Whether professional athlete or weekend warrior, the population is more active than ever, both working and playing hard. With this trend has come an increasing desire to maximize performance while minimizing injury, which has led many to seek the unique skill-set of the sports chiropractor to help them achieve this goal.
In addition to the athlete, race organizers are also actively seeking the services of the sports practitioner for the benefit of their competitors. For the past 16 years, event organizers throughout the state of California have sought the services of the Palmer West Sports Council to help minimize athlete injuries through both pre and post-event treatment, including injury evaluation, chiropractic manipulation, stretching, soft-tissue therapy, and taping. Council members are trained in both on and off-field settings, which includes course material focusing on sport-specific injury evaluation and treatment protocols. Students are CPR certified, and have training in common athletic emergency situations.
